Головна

Уточнення поняття концептуальної моделі

  1. I. Основні поняття ОРГАНІЗАЦІЙНОЇ СОЦІАЛЬНОЇ ПСИХОЛОГІЇ
  2. V етап. Синтез комп'ютерної моделі об'єкта.
  3. А) Моделі загального попиту
  4. Адміністративні покарання: поняття, цілі, види
  5. Актуальні комунікаційні моделі ЗМІ.
  6. Актуальні комунікаційні моделі ЗМІ.
  7. Алгоритм моделювання. Характеристики кожного етапу

У базі даних відображається деяка частина реального світу. Природно, що повнота її опису буде залежати від цілей створюваної інформаційної системи.

Частина реального світу, що представляє інтерес для даного дослідження, називається предметною областю (ПО). Для того щоб база даних адекватно відображала предметну область, проектувальник повинен добре уявляти собі всі нюанси, властиві їй, і вміти відобразити їх в базі даних.

Предметна область повинна бути попередньо описана. Для цього, в принципі, може використовуватися і природна мова, але його застосування має багато недоліків, основні з яких - громіздкість описи і неоднозначність його трактування. Тому зазвичай для цих цілей використовують штучні формалізовані (найчастіше - графічні) мовні засоби.

Формалізований опис предметної області будемо називати її концептуальної (КМ), або инфологической (Илм), моделлю. Предметні області можуть бути різними, і для їх моделювання можуть знадобитися специфічні засоби, що відповідають особливостям цих областей. В даному навчальному посібнику розглядаються в основному економіко-організаційні системи. Хоча описувані далі підходи до

проектування є більш універсальними і можуть бути використані і в інших предметних областях.

Моделювання предметних областей виконується з різними цілями, наприклад, для реінжинірингу бізнес-процесів, для прогнозування розвитку предметної області, при проектуванні баз даних та програмного забезпечення і ін. Використовувані засоби і методи моделювання при цьому будуть відрізнятися.

Як було відзначено в розділі 1, існує велика різноманітність видів БД. Підходи до проектування баз даних різних класів будуть мати відчутні відмінності. Так як в даний час основну частину баз даних представляють структуровані бази даних, то основна увага буде приділена проектування саме таких систем.

Стадія інфологіческого моделювання - вихідна і результативна інформація

Вивчення предметної області складається з безпосереднього спостереження протікають в ній процесів, вивчення документів, що циркулюють в системі, а також інтерв'ювання учасників цих процесів (рис. 2.1). Так як опис інфологічної моделі виконується на спеціалізованому мові, то необхідно володіння цим

мовою. Слід звернути увагу на те, що можливості мови опису ІМЛ впливають на методику побудови моделі з використанням даних мовних засобів. Побудова концептуальної моделі може виконуватися як «вручну», так і з використанням автоматизованих засобів проектування. Засоби автоматизації проектування відрізняються як сукупністю використовуваних мовних засобів, так і

алгоритмами перетворення концептуальної моделі в моделі бази даних. Це в свою чергу позначиться на методиці побудови моделі в їх середовищі.

Загальна структура команди Select мови SQL. | Вимоги, що пред'являються до концептуальної моделі


Екзаменаційний білет N 1. | Екзаменаційний білет N 2. | Екзаменаційний білет N 3. | Підтримка наявності можливих ключів в таблиці. | Тенденції розвитку СУБД. | Аномалії модифікації даних | нормалізація відносин | Табличні мови запитів. Особливості обробки полів різних типів. Робота з обчислюваними полями. Використання агрегуються функцій. | Переваги використання ER-моделювання | Екзаменаційний білет N 8. |

© 2016-2022  um.co.ua - учбові матеріали та реферати